One of the most noticeable changes is the increased popularity of live, or in-play, betting. Instead of placing wagers before a game begins, fans can now make predictions during the match itself. This interactive style of betting allows users to engage more deeply with the action, whether it’s predicting the next goal in soccer or the outcome of a single tennis set. This real-time involvement adds intensity to every moment of the game and helps keep fans glued to their screens.
Sports organizations have also felt the impact of this evolution. Many leagues and clubs have partnered with online betting companies to create sponsorship deals, advertising opportunities, and even dedicated betting platforms. These partnerships generate significant revenue streams, which can then be reinvested into player development, stadium upgrades, and community programs. While some critics worry about the influence of gambling on sports culture, the financial benefits are undeniable.
The introduction of mobile betting has been another game-changer. Fans can now place bets directly from their smartphones while watching a match at home or in the stadium. The convenience of mobile apps has contributed to a massive increase in betting participation worldwide. Push notifications, promotions, and live updates keep users engaged, ensuring they never miss an opportunity to place a wager.
Data and analytics also play a critical role in shaping modern betting experiences. Online platforms now provide users with detailed statistics, performance trends, and expert predictions. This information empowers fans to make more informed decisions rather than relying solely on gut instincts. For sports organizations, the growing emphasis on analytics has created opportunities to engage fans with deeper insights into player performance and game strategies.
However, with the rise of online betting comes the need for responsible gambling practices. Sports leagues and betting platforms are increasingly working together to promote safe betting habits. This includes offering tools like deposit limits, time-out features, and self-exclusion programs. Public awareness campaigns also emphasize the importance of gambling responsibly to prevent addiction and protect vulnerable individuals.
Looking to the future, the integration of emerging technologies such as virtual reality, blockchain, and artificial intelligence is set to further transform the sports-betting landscape. VR could create immersive fan experiences where users can watch matches in virtual stadiums while placing live bets. Blockchain may offer greater transparency and security, while AI-driven algorithms could provide more accurate betting tips tailored to individual users.
